#5db455 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5db455 is composed of 36.5% red, 70.6% green and 33.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 52.8% yellow and 29.4% black. It has a hue angle of 114.9 degrees, a saturation of 38.8% and a lightness of 52%. #5db455 color hex could be obtained by blending #baffaa with #006900.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

#5db455 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5db455 has RGB values of R:93, G:180, B:85 and CMYK values of C:0.48, M:0, Y:0.53,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 6141013.
